"Song Test" comes from Desolation Wilderness, a young musician from Olympia, Washingon, USA, who's been experimenting with the electronic means of sonic expression for almost four years now.
The structure of all 5 tracks from this EP seems to be built on two levels: the minimal, cold and distant notes in the foreground vs. lots of interesting and important quiet sounds in the background.
Just as the title says: it's full of unfinished melodies and emotional warm synths which stop abruptly from time to time to give you an insight to what is hidden 'under the surface'.
Feels as if the listener was pushed to cross the border of artificial emotions to discover the wealth of the reality somewhere deep or in a distance.
Of course this is only our subjective interpretation of this music, still there are lots of other traces waiting for you to follow in these works...
